Unfortunately I'm not a Fairlight user. But my main sampler is the Emulator III.

How is it that no-one has ever released CD-ROM's in a contemporary audio format with 
the Fairlight Series III library on it?

The EIII library CD-ROM's are widely available, The IIx library can be found on CD-ROM 
and at one time the Synclavier library was available on CD-ROM's. But no Series III to this 
day...

I don't think that it's a question of copyright since the IIx library is already out there. 

So what's the main reason? Is it because no-one has ever found the time to convert the 
4GB of samples? 
Or is the library part of the value of second hand Series III? Meaning that if the library 
should be widely available it would lower the appeal and second hand prices of the Series 
III?

So are there any other non-Fairlight users out there that want it?

Is anyone planning to convert the library in the future?
